Atlas-Assistance-Dogs / atlas-dogs

Repository for Atlas Dogs flows in Salesforce
1 stars 1 forks source link

File upload not displaying the proper categories in beta11 or 12 #514

Closed atlasjen closed 3 months ago

atlasjen commented 4 months ago

The file upload is not showing all possible categories . this is as of 2/20/24 in the beta11 sandbox. For example, Ortiz Kylie only have Trainer and Volunteer as category options. He should also have Client, Team Facilitator and Standalone as well as NA image

I tested a few other folks. Similar oddities. I haven't been able to figure out a pattern yet. I tried tweaking statuses for the positions, but that didn't resolve it. Anthony Liu doesn't show any category options

image

atlasjen commented 4 months ago

I realized Client shouldn't be showing as that is just teamclient.. but the others should still be showing. I wonder if this is related to permissions? let me know when you have a chance to look at this. once this is resolved i can start testing various types of "users" w differnt permissions.. still working w this w me as a user w all new permissions.

deb761 commented 4 months ago

I figured it out. There was an error in the logic for finding which groups a user was a member of. I have a new beta package coming.

deb761 commented 4 months ago

Fixed!

image
atlasjen commented 4 months ago

testing in beta11. 2/26 and comparing to production. Progress. I am seeing more category types :)

  1. I don't think we should see "Team Client" as a option for file types to upload under contact if someone is a client? aren't those only uploaded under the Team?

image

  1. Remind me about Assistance Dogs Set in Motion files.. i guess those aren't a position, so we left them for everyone, is that right? Pretty sure that is how we have it in prod. we might want to change this but can punt on it for later.

image

  1. I am no longer seeing "N/A" as a category option. (look in examples above) In prod, we could pick N/A and then a type of "Contact Form" or no type. That said, i can upload a file w/o a category or type, so maybe that makes more sense than the NA. Curious of the intended change here. I am also no longer seeing "standalone" as a type for everyone, which is good.. so again, the NA may be intentional and i am cool w it.. just double checking. In that case i think we'd want to move Contact Form under each type vs having it under NA, so if we did save a contact form, we have something to specify. I am curious what logic impacts the "Last Contact Form" date now.

  2. Puppy Raiser isn't showing as a possible file type even if it is a position. The others all do appear. image

  3. If someone is a Team Facilitator and Team Facilitator Lead, Team Facilitator is present twice as a category type. Note, this is also true in prod i just realized. image

atlasjen commented 4 months ago

For this release we are accepting

atlasjen commented 3 months ago

testing in beta12, i added Team Facilitator as a status to someone who already had Team Facilitator Lead. I have refreshed a few times, but i only see "NA" as a file upload option. image

atlasjen commented 3 months ago

I tried adding client and same issue.

deb761 commented 3 months ago

I had forgotten to add you, Molly, and Laura to the "All" group. You should see it now.

atlasjen commented 3 months ago

Ok. yep, working as expected. closing.